Introduction

Maria Georgatou is a renowned rhythmic gymnast hailing from Athens, Greece. Born on May 10, 1984, Maria has made a name for herself in the world of gymnastics with her exceptional skills and dedication to the sport. With a career spanning over two decades, Maria has achieved numerous accolades and represented her country on the international stage with pride.

Olympic Dreams

One of Maria’s biggest goals as a gymnast was to compete in the Olympic Games and represent Greece on the world’s biggest stage. In 2004, her dream came true when she qualified for the Athens Olympics, held in her hometown. The experience was a highlight of her career, as she competed against the best gymnasts in the world and proudly represented her country.
